On my oldest ice, MetaLink I think, it requires you to qualify local variables by function and file (module). Most new ICE's do this for you. Thanks for the tip about the SI Labs ICE. So far I'm not terribly impressed with it. It's pretty basic compared to the Acqura one that I'm totally smitten with. One also runs into problems when the variable is kept in a register and never makes it to RAM.
